The Actual Tech Behind ‘eye Saver’ Modes
Forget the flashy names. What people usually mean when they ask ‘does laptop monitor have eye savers’ is referring to features designed to reduce eye strain. The primary culprit is often blue light, that high-energy visible light emitted by screens. Some screens have dedicated modes—often labeled ‘Eye Saver’, ‘Night Mode’, ‘ComfortView’, or ‘Reader Mode’—that shift the display’s color temperature towards warmer tones, effectively filtering out some of that blue light.
Think of it like adjusting the white balance on a camera. When it’s set to a cool, bluish tone, everything can feel a bit stark and harsh, especially after hours of staring. Warm it up, and it feels softer, more natural, like looking at paper under a lamp instead of a harsh fluorescent.

Why Everyone Says Blue Light Is Evil (and Why It’s More Complicated)
Everyone and their dog will tell you blue light is the devil. It messes with your sleep cycle, it causes digital eye strain, blah blah blah. And yeah, there’s truth to it. The retina is particularly sensitive to blue light, and prolonged exposure, especially before bed, can indeed mess with your circadian rhythm—your body’s internal clock. This can make it harder to fall asleep.
However, there’s a significant amount of hype. Not all blue light is bad. Sunlight, which we definitely need, is a massive source of blue light. The issue is the concentrated, prolonged exposure from digital devices, often in environments where our natural light cues are diminished (like being indoors all day). How to Actually Find and Use Eye Saver Features
So, how do you know if your laptop monitor has eye savers, or more accurately, how do you access these features? It’s usually buried in the display settings. On Windows, look for ‘Night light.’ On macOS, it’s ‘Night Shift.’ Many manufacturers also have their own branded software, like Dell’s ComfortView or Lenovo’s Eye Care Mode.
Windows: Go to Settings > System > Display. You’ll find ‘Night light’ there. You can turn it on manually or schedule it to turn on automatically after sunset. You can also adjust the ‘Strength’ of the warmth.
macOS: Go to System Preferences > Displays > Night Shift. Similar to Windows, you can schedule it and adjust the color temperature. The icon usually looks like a sun setting.
ChromeOS: Go to Settings > Display > Night Mode. It’s pretty straightforward. (See Also: Does Hertz Monitor For Smokers )
Android/iOS: Most smartphones have ‘Night Mode’ or ‘Blue Light Filter’ in their quick settings panel or under Display settings.
The key is experimentation. What feels comfortable for one person might be too warm or too cool for another. Start with the default settings and tweak the intensity until you find a sweet spot. It’s less about blocking a specific percentage of blue light and more about creating a visually comfortable experience for *your* eyes.
Beyond Blue Light: Other Factors Affecting Eye Strain
While blue light gets all the press, it’s not the only villain. The brightness of your screen, its contrast, and even the refresh rate play a part. Trying to use a super-bright screen in a dark room is like staring into a spotlight. Conversely, a dim screen in a bright room makes you strain to see. Think of it like trying to read a book in a poorly lit corner versus a well-lit study. The latter is always easier on the eyes. Adjusting your screen’s brightness to match your ambient lighting is probably more impactful than fiddling with blue light filters.
Also, consider your posture and how far away you are from the screen. The 20-20-20 rule—every 20 minutes, look at something 20 feet away for at least 20 seconds—is surprisingly effective, even if it sounds like something a kindergarten teacher would say. It’s not just about the screen tech; it’s about how you use it.

When Software Isn’t Enough: Hardware Considerations
Sometimes, software tweaks only go so far. If your laptop is several years old, its screen panel might just be inherently more reflective or have poorer color accuracy, which can contribute to eye strain regardless of software filters. This is where the quality of the display panel itself comes into play. Newer laptops, especially those marketed for professionals or creators, often feature higher-quality panels with better coatings and color reproduction, which indirectly helps with eye comfort because you’re not fighting the screen as much.
For instance, a cheap TN panel might have terrible viewing angles and a washed-out look, forcing you to hunch over and strain your eyes to see anything clearly. An IPS panel, on the other hand, offers much wider viewing angles and better color fidelity. It’s like comparing a blurry, low-resolution photograph to a crisp, high-definition image. Do All Laptops Have an Eye Saver Mode?
No, not all laptops have a dedicated ‘eye saver’ mode with a specific name. However, most modern operating systems (Windows, macOS, ChromeOS) include built-in features like ‘Night light’ or ‘Night Shift’ that perform a similar function by adjusting color temperature. If your laptop is very old or runs a very basic OS, it might not have this feature readily available.
Is Blue Light Filtering Actually Effective for Eye Strain?
It’s effective for some aspects, particularly in regulating your circadian rhythm and potentially making screens more comfortable to view in low light. However, the direct link between blue light filtering and reducing *all* forms of digital eye strain is less clear-cut. Other factors like screen brightness, glare, and proper viewing habits often play a larger role.
Can I Add an Eye Saver Feature to an Older Laptop?
Yes, you can often add similar functionality through third-party software. Applications like f.lux (for Windows and macOS) or Redshift (for Linux) can automatically adjust your screen’s color temperature based on the time of day, mimicking the effect of built-in night modes. They are generally free and can make a noticeable difference.
Is It Better to Use an App or Buy Blue Light Glasses?
For most people, using built-in software features or free third-party apps like f.lux is a more practical and cost-effective first step than buying blue light glasses. Software adjusts the screen itself, which is directly controllable and often better calibrated than generic glasses, which might filter too much or too little light, or fit poorly.
